Purpose of the job
To deliver ICT Research & Innovation services within the Research & Innovation department to and pro-active distribution of research material to both government clients and SITA business units so that all relevant information is updated and is available for informed decision making.
Key Responsibility Areas
Participate in developing and implementing Research & Innovation strategies and roadmaps (from an ICT Research & Innovation perspective) to ensure a comprehensive and integrated Research and Innovation function;
Participate in the development, implementation and evaluation of governance mechanisms for ICT Research & Innovation and monitor the adherence thereto so as to deliver quality products in a controlled environment;
Participate in the development and implementation of Architectural mechanisms, by providing research to support the development of GWEA to improve interoperability of government systems by the ICT Research & Innovation;
Provide pro-active ICT research services and distribution of research material to government departments and to SITA internal business units so as to meet: ICT Research & Innovation service delivery commitments;
Provide basic research on public services and impact on citizens so as to meet ICT Research & Innovation service delivery commitments;
Ensure that resources are kept abreast of the latest industry developments and ensure that appropriate technologies are used for knowledge management so as to ensure that innovation and improved productivity;
Develop and execute stakeholder relationship management plans to enable effective management and improvement of stakeholder relationships.
Qualifications and Experience
Minimum: Bachelor’s degree in ICT or related field (Computer Science, Information Systems, Technology and Engineering) or equivalent.
Experience: 3 - 5 years experience in research in the ICT field, including research on ICT and digital technologies and market analysis.
Experience in ICT research within the corporate/public sector, including Research and published papers or report on IT or digital technologies; Research analysis of efficient and effective IT solutions to diverse and complex business problems.
Technical Competencies Description
Knowledge of: Digital technologies trends IT and Cyber Security; ICT Standards; IT Strategies and Architectures; Project Management; ICT business environment and landscape; Government Wide Enterprise Architecture; Government’s Technology Requirements; Government Business Reference Model and Strategy Formulation; Business, statistical and market analysis; and Report writing.
